A security review of telemetry collectors, which receive logs, metrics, and traces and send them to storage or monitoring systems. It checks whether untrusted telemetry can control what the collector does.

In plain words
What is it for?
Use it to review collector endpoints, telemetry processors, routing rules, exporters, and permissions. It is for checking authentication and preventing attacker-controlled fields from driving actions.
Why use it?
It helps find paths where anyone who can send telemetry might inject data, trigger processing, or reach sensitive systems through the collector's credentials.

Auditing observability pipeline collector trust: when telemetry is an untrusted input

A telemetry collector sits in a trusted spot, workloads and infrastructure send it their logs, metrics, and traces, and it forwards, transforms, and stores that data with credentials that reach real backends. That position makes it an under-examined trust boundary. The data it ingests is often accepted without authenticating the sender, so anyone who can reach the ingestion endpoint can inject telemetry. The processors that transform that data can be driven by fields the sender controls, and a processor that executes, routes, or queries based on a telemetry field acts on attacker input. The collector's own credentials and exporters can reach sensitive destinations, so compromising the pipeline reaches the backends it writes to. You audit these by checking whether ingestion is authenticated and whether any processor or exporter acts on attacker-controllable content.

When to use

  • A telemetry collector or agent ingests logs, metrics, or traces from workloads or the network.
  • The collector transforms, routes, or stores telemetry, and processors may read sender-controlled fields.
  • The collector runs with credentials whose exporters reach databases, object stores, or other backends.

Scope check

Test collectors and pipelines only in environments you own or are authorized to assess, on non-production telemetry. Injecting telemetry or exercising a processor touches a live pipeline, so keep any payload benign and inside the authorized environment. If you can't name the authorization, stop.

The loop

  1. Establish the intended senders first. Name who is supposed to send telemetry to each ingestion endpoint: which workloads, which agents. This is the false-positive killer: an endpoint reachable only by authenticated intended senders, whose processors treat telemetry as inert data, is correct. Name the senders, then check ingestion and processing against that.

  2. Check ingestion authentication and reachability. Determine whether each ingestion endpoint authenticates the sender or accepts telemetry from anyone who can reach it. An unauthenticated endpoint reachable beyond the intended senders lets an attacker inject arbitrary logs, metrics, or traces, which is the entry point for everything downstream. Confirm the network reachability and the auth requirement.
